Skate Park Fees and Registration Procedures
- All participants will be required to complete a registration form and release of liability prior to using the park.
- Anyone under the age of 18 must have a parent complete and sign this form prior to participation.
- Forms CANNOT be completed by another child's parent.
- Anyone 18 and over must have proof of age in order to complete the forms without a parent signature.
- Individual sessions can be purchased at the skate park office only, 15 minutes prior to the start of a new session.
- Skaters under the age of 10 must be accompanied by a parent or adult at all times.
- Membership passes will be available for purchase at the Jupiter Community Center soon (check this site for updates on when passes will go on sale), located at 210 Military Trail.
- All members will receive a photo ID that will allow admission into the park for any session, provided space is available.
- Proof of residency is required in the form of a driver's license AND one of the following: lease agreement, cable bill, tax bill, telephone bill or utility bill. Failure to show proof of residency will require payment of the non-resident fee.
- Space at the skate park is first come, first serve basis with a maximum capacity of 50 skaters per session.
| | INCORPORATED JUPITER RESIDENTS | NON-RESIDENTS | (1) 3-HOUR SESSION available at Skate Park Office only | $5 | $6 | SEMI-ANNUAL PASS (6 months) available at Jupiter Community Center only | $75 | $90
| ANNUAL PASS (1 year) available at Jupiter Community Center only | $125 | $150
| | PLEASE NOTE THAT SEMI-ANNUAL AND ANNUAL PASSES ARE GOOD FOR SKATING DURING ANY SESSION PROVIDED SPACE IS AVAILABLE IN THE PARK. PASSES DO NOT GUARANTEE ADMISSION IF PARK IS AT MAXIMUM CAPACITY! |
